Abstract

Precision agriculture is a management strategy that employs detailed site specific information to precisely manage production inputs. Precision farming can contribute in many ways to long-term sustainability of agricul- ture. The idea is to know the soil and crop characteristics unique to each part of the field, and to optimize the production inputs within small portions of the field. Of all the production inputs, nutrients occupy the top position and nutrient management is crucial to the success of any farming system. The usual practice is to apply nutri- ents at one rate throughout the farming area. Such practice could lead to wastage of resources and maximum yields could not be achieved since, spatial variability is altogether ignored in the management option. Precision nutrient management system offers improved land stewardship, optimizes resource usage, since every part of a field receives precise amount of fertilizer required to maximize crop yields. Various strategies of precision nu- trient management system are being developed among which management zone technique is gaining impor- tance. The management zone strategy reduced the average N applied from 6.3 % to 46.1 % compared to uni- form N management. The variable rate N application using management zones increased net returns from 11.75 to $ 39.17/ha over uniform N management.
